Configuring Workflow Process or Task UI Version Handling
Depending on value of the Status property, you can control how versions of a Workflow Process or task UI that you open with an editor are handled. The following procedure shows how to configure the options for handling Workflow Process or task UI versions.
This task is a step in Process of Setting Up the Development Environment.
To control Workflow Process or task UI version handling
-
Select Options from the View menu.
-
In the Development Tools Options dialog box, select the General tab.
In the Workflow and Task Configurations section, configure the options as required. The following table describes the available options.
Option Description Automatic Revision in WF/Task Editor and Version Check
Select or deselect the check box as required.
If Selected and if you use an editor to open a Workflow Process or task UI and the Status property on the Workflow Process or task UI is Completed, then a copy of the Workflow Process or task UI is created, the status on the copy is set to In Progress, and an editable version of it is opened in the editor.
-
If Deselected, then the editor opens and displays a version of the Workflow Process or task UI that you cannot edit.
Automatically Close All the Previous WF/Task Versions
Select or deselect the check box as required.
-
If Selected and if you use an editor to open a Workflow Process or task UI and the Status property on the Workflow Process or task UI is Completed, Not In Use, or Expired, then any prior versions of the Workflow Process or task UI are closed.
-
If Deselected, then any prior versions of the Workflow Process or task UI are not automatically closed.
-
Click OK.
